We’ve had our Bunn 12-cup brewer for about 5 years & it works great. My favorite thing about it is that it keeps a reservoir of hot water, so it starts brewing immediately when filled. Brews 12 cups in ~3 mins.
This seems awfully fancy for “no frills”. We have a Bunn O Matic commercial that will outlive me. Only downside is that they are always on, so if you don’t put a timer on it you will use a lot of electricity. Upside is that you can even plumb in the fresh water supply if you like.
Something to know about the big commercial brewers that I have worked with is that fresh water is pumped into the water tank as the brew is happening. The tank water is heated to 195° to 200° and held there until the operator chooses to brew coffee. The freshly pumped water cools the water in the tank, so your overall brew temp rapidly decreases. The range of temps that the coffee is exposed to during the brew process is large.
I second this. Always look to the commercial products. Simple, less buttons and less electronic circuitry to short and fail. Our Bunn at my 24/7 workplace sees multiple pots per day over three shifts. Still going strong for the over 20 years I’ve been here.
Do you care how it looks? The commercial Bunn machines are pretty plastic free with the right accessories. Can find them for around $500 used. Will last forever.
Don’t buy a commercial Bunn for your house. Not only are they big and gargantuan, they stay on 24 hours keeping the water hot so it can brew a pot in a couple minutes. They’re designed for businesses brewing coffee all day. You can turn it on and off, but they’re not designed for that and you’re going to kill it because they’re not designed to be turned on and off. And commercial products, your warranty is immediately void if you’re using it in a residential setting and not in a commercial setting.
